Step 4 — Partner SFTP Drop (Vexler Logistics). Their nightly feed lands in the inbound drop and is swept by the Cartwheel ingester every 15 minutes. Do not rename files; the sweeper keys off the prefix. Failures go to the quarantine folder and retry three times. Before running the sweep locally, confirm your sandbox matches production. The connection and path settings are as follows:

config for bahop-fajep:
DRUATH_PIN=4501
DRUATH_TENANT=briwyn
DRUATH_METRICS_HOST=metrics.druath.brasksoft.test
DRUATH_SEAL=seal_7d2e069d
DRUATH_STANDBY_TEAM=olieth

Welcome to checkout support at Marlowe Threads!

Once a quarter we load test the checkout flow using the Stampede harness, which replays synthetic carts against the staging store. You'll see tickets spike during these windows — they're fake orders, so don't panic or refund anything. The schedule is posted a week ahead, and test orders are tagged so you can filter them out. The upcoming run calendar and filtering guide live on the page linked below.

dashboard of kahof-kajef = https://confluence.braskdata.corp/spaces

Handover — build infra (Orlin to Maret)

Build agents in the Kestrelworks pool drift; agent-7 runs about 40s fast. NTP sync is flaky on the Dunmere rack, so signed artifacts occasionally fail timestamp validation. Restart chronyd first, don't rebuild. If you need the skew-override console and your login fails, use the recovery passphrase below.

vault phrase of tajef-tafog = istox-sorax-zorox-casok-holox-kelix-weneth-drueth-casion

Changelog — Fenwick Gateway 2.8. We finally changed the circuit breaker defaults for the upstream Marlet API after last month's flap-fest. The breaker now trips faster on consecutive timeouts and holds open longer before probing, which cut retry storms in canary by about 80%. Heads up: services pinning the old defaults should drop their overrides. The new shipped defaults for the breaker are as follows.

config for kafof-bawef:
holath:
  log_level: debug
  metrics_host: metrics.holath.qorvelsys.internal
  pin: 2191
  pool_size: 32